Output e5b658373f60b6f52de41c8614ef48321e77bfe5559f4ccfa3ac031e4fa1ca8f:0

value
29994868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b496f1a0be525b7186f90254ba252d99275f7f18 OP_EQUAL
address
3J9tNqTxN2rM3fXT1j3RKwfGvH9ok5Kp41
transaction
e5b658373f60b6f52de41c8614ef48321e77bfe5559f4ccfa3ac031e4fa1ca8f
spent
true